Poznań City Center

Poznań City Centre captivates visitors with its stunning Renaissance buildings surrounding the Gothic Town Hall in Stary Rynek. Colourful townhouses and cobblestone streets create a fairy-tale atmosphere perfect for exploring on foot. Museums like the National Museum showcase Polish culture and regional history. Traditional pierogi restaurants and atmospheric cellar pubs offer authentic Polish experiences alongside modern cafés. Artisan workshops sell handcrafted amber jewellery and wooden crafts throughout the district. The area's university presence adds youthful energy to this walkable historic district where medieval charm meets contemporary Polish life.

Stare Miasto District

Stare Miasto District charms visitors with its perfectly preserved medieval architecture and cobblestone streets dating back to the 13th century. The Old Market Square features a Renaissance town hall where mechanical goats butt heads at noon. Gothic churches and colourful merchant houses create a living tapestry of Polish history. Traditional music echoes off ancient walls. Explore this pedestrian-friendly zone on foot to discover authentic Polish culture around every corner. Local restaurants serve regional Greater Poland cuisine in historic cellars and courtyards. Visit the Royal Castle, Imperial Castle, and National Museum to experience Poznań's rich heritage. The district feels genuinely medieval despite its popularity with tourists.

Jezyce

Art Nouveau elegance defines Jezyce, a charming historic district in Poznań where locals outnumber tourists. Beautiful tenement houses line tree-lined streets, offering glimpses into Polish architectural heritage. Kraszewskiego Street buzzes with hip cafés and alternative bars where you can experience authentic local culture. The area balances history with modern Polish life perfectly. Explore the nearby Zoological Gardens or catch a performance at Nowy Theatre. Efficient tram lines connect you to city centre Poznań within minutes, making this peaceful residential area an ideal base for city exploration.

Grunwald

Grunwald offers an authentic slice of local Poznań life with leafy streets and family-friendly vibes away from tourist crowds. Wilson Park's manicured gardens and the expansive Marcelinski Forest provide peaceful retreats within this residential haven. The area hums with student energy from nearby Adam Mickiewicz University facilities. You'll discover budget-friendly Polish eateries serving hearty pierogi throughout the area. Sports enthusiasts can visit Lech Poznań Stadium, while nature lovers will appreciate the Poznań Palm House with its exotic plant collections. Regular city buses connect to central Poznań, making exploration convenient and easy.

The Renaissance Old Town Square comes alive with colourful merchant houses and the daily noon show of mechanical fighting goats. Explore the interactive exhibits at Porta Posnania museum before sampling local St. Martin's croissants, a sweet speciality protected by EU designation.

Best time to go to Poznań

The best time to visit Poznań is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January31.3°F (-0.4°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February33.1°F (0.6°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
March39.6°F (4.2°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April48.6°F (9.2°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May56.7°F (13.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June64.6°F (18.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July67.8°F (19.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
August68.0°F (20.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
September59.9°F (15.5°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
October50.2°F (10.1°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
November41.7°F (5.4°C)No R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December34.3°F (1.3°C)No R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What's the weather like in Poznań?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 1°C. Average annual precipitation for Poznań is 640 mm.
